Integration Testing in Software Architect Kit (Publication Date: 2024/02)

$375.00
Adding to cart… The item has been added
Attention all software architects!

Are you tired of spending countless hours trying to make sense of integration testing for your projects? Look no further!

Our Integration Testing in Software Architect Knowledge Base is here to save the day.

Our dataset includes 1502 prioritized requirements, solutions, benefits, and results specifically tailored for integration testing in software architecture.

But what sets us apart from competitors and alternatives? Our product is designed by professionals, for professionals.

We understand the importance of efficiency and reliability in software development, and that′s exactly what our dataset offers.

Not only does our knowledge base provide essential questions to ask in order to get results quickly and effectively, but it also includes real-life case studies and use cases to guide you through integrating testing in your projects.

This allows for a deeper understanding of how our dataset can be applied to real-world scenarios.

Our Integration Testing in Software Architect Knowledge Base also offers an affordable and DIY alternative to costly and time-consuming methods.

With a detailed overview of the product specifications, users can easily navigate and use the dataset for their own integration testing needs.

But why invest in our product? The benefits are endless.

With our knowledge base, you can save valuable time and resources by avoiding trial and error in your integration testing processes.

Our dataset also provides in-depth research on integration testing, giving you a competitive edge in the software development industry.

And it′s not just for individual use.

Our Integration Testing in Software Architect Knowledge Base is also beneficial for businesses.

It allows for a streamlined and standardized approach to integration testing, leading to faster project completion and increased client satisfaction.

But don′t just take our word for it.

Our dataset provides a comprehensive list of pros and cons, so you can make an informed decision about whether it′s the right fit for you and your company.

In summary, our Integration Testing in Software Architect Knowledge Base is the ultimate tool for any software architect looking to enhance their integration testing process.

It′s affordable, user-friendly, and the most comprehensive dataset on the market.

Don′t waste any more time and resources, invest in our product today and see immediate results in your software development projects.



Discover Insights, Make Informed Decisions, and Stay Ahead of the Curve:



  • Are there any frequent changes in your project whose approval could be automated?
  • Does your organization automate integration, component, or performance testing?
  • What specific frequency requirements were identified for development systems integration testing?


  • Key Features:


    • Comprehensive set of 1502 prioritized Integration Testing requirements.
    • Extensive coverage of 151 Integration Testing topic scopes.
    • In-depth analysis of 151 Integration Testing step-by-step solutions, benefits, BHAGs.
    • Detailed examination of 151 Integration Testing case studies and use cases.

    • Digital download upon purchase.
    • Enjoy lifetime document updates included with your purchase.
    • Benefit from a fully editable and customizable Excel format.
    • Trusted and utilized by over 10,000 organizations.

    • Covering: Enterprise Architecture Patterns, Protection Policy, Responsive Design, System Design, Version Control, Progressive Web Applications, Web Technologies, Commerce Platforms, White Box Testing, Information Retrieval, Data Exchange, Design for Compliance, API Development, System Testing, Data Security, Test Effectiveness, Clustering Analysis, Layout Design, User Authentication, Supplier Quality, Virtual Reality, Software Architecture Patterns, Infrastructure As Code, Serverless Architecture, Systems Review, Microservices Architecture, Consumption Recovery, Natural Language Processing, External Processes, Stress Testing, Feature Flags, OODA Loop Model, Cloud Computing, Billing Software, Design Patterns, Decision Traceability, Design Systems, Energy Recovery, Mobile First Design, Frontend Development, Software Maintenance, Tooling Design, Backend Development, Code Documentation, DER Regulations, Process Automation Robotic Workforce, AI Practices, Distributed Systems, Software Development, Competitor intellectual property, Map Creation, Augmented Reality, Human Computer Interaction, User Experience, Content Distribution Networks, Agile Methodologies, Container Orchestration, Portfolio Evaluation, Web Components, Memory Functions, Asset Management Strategy, Object Oriented Design, Integrated Processes, Continuous Delivery, Disk Space, Configuration Management, Modeling Complexity, Software Implementation, Software architecture design, Policy Compliance Audits, Unit Testing, Application Architecture, Modular Architecture, Lean Software Development, Source Code, Operational Technology Security, Using Visualization Techniques, Machine Learning, Functional Testing, Iteration planning, Web Performance Optimization, Agile Frameworks, Secure Network Architecture, Business Integration, Extreme Programming, Software Development Lifecycle, IT Architecture, Acceptance Testing, Compatibility Testing, Customer Surveys, Time Based Estimates, IT Systems, Online Community, Team Collaboration, Code Refactoring, Regression Testing, Code Set, Systems Architecture, Network Architecture, Agile Architecture, data warehouses, Code Reviews Management, Code Modularity, ISO 26262, Grid Software, Test Driven Development, Error Handling, Internet Of Things, Network Security, User Acceptance Testing, Integration Testing, Technical Debt, Rule Dependencies, Software Architecture, Debugging Tools, Code Reviews, Programming Languages, Service Oriented Architecture, Security Architecture Frameworks, Server Side Rendering, Client Side Rendering, Cross Platform Development, Software Architect, Application Development, Web Security, Technology Consulting, Test Driven Design, Project Management, Performance Optimization, Deployment Automation, Agile Planning, Domain Driven Development, Content Management Systems, IT Staffing, Multi Tenant Architecture, Game Development, Mobile Applications, Continuous Flow, Data Visualization, Software Testing, Responsible AI Implementation, Artificial Intelligence, Continuous Integration, Load Testing, Usability Testing, Development Team, Accessibility Testing, Database Management, Business Intelligence, User Interface, Master Data Management




    Integration Testing Assessment Dataset - Utilization, Solutions, Advantages, BHAG (Big Hairy Audacious Goal):


    Integration Testing


    Integration testing is a type of software testing that aims to check the compatibility and functionality of different components when integrated together. It is used to identify any possible issues or bugs that may arise due to frequent changes in the project and determine if they can be automatically approved.


    1. Implement continuous integration (CI) to detect changes and run tests automatically.
    2. Use virtualized environments for testing to reduce manual setup and save time.
    3. Utilize tools like Jenkins or Travis CI for automated deployment of test environments.
    4. Implement code review practices to catch potential integration issues early on.
    5. Use a version control system to manage changes and track any potential conflicts.
    6. Use API testing tools like Postman or SoapUI to automate integration tests for APIs.
    7. Develop comprehensive test suites that cover all integration scenarios.
    8. Use test automation frameworks like Selenium to automate GUI testing for web applications.
    9. Utilize mock objects to simulate external dependencies for isolated integration testing.
    10. Conduct regular regression testing to ensure new changes do not break existing integrations.
    Benefits:
    1. Decreased turnaround time for detecting integration issues.
    2. More efficient usage of testing resources.
    3. Faster deployment and quicker feedback on integration errors.
    4. Improved code quality through early detection of integration issues.
    5. Better organization and tracking of project changes.
    6. Reduced manual effort and human error in integration testing.
    7. Increased test coverage for various integration scenarios.
    8. Quicker identification and resolution of GUI-related integration problems.
    9. Improved efficiency and flexibility for testing in different environments.
    10. Ensuring stability and reliability of existing integrations with frequent regression testing.

    CONTROL QUESTION: Are there any frequent changes in the project whose approval could be automated?


    Big Hairy Audacious Goal (BHAG) for 10 years from now:

    By the year 2031, my ambitious goal for Integration Testing is to have complete automation and integration of all test cases and approvals within the project. This will include the ability to automatically detect any changes made in the project, whether it be code, configuration, or requirements, and generate corresponding automated test cases and approval requests.

    This automation process will drastically reduce the time and effort required for integration testing, allowing for faster and more efficient delivery of high-quality software. It will also greatly decrease the chances of human error and ensure that all changes are properly tested and approved before being implemented.

    The automation will also be integrated with the project management system, allowing for seamless tracking and reporting of testing progress and results. This will provide real-time visibility and enable quick decision-making for project stakeholders.

    Overall, this ambitious goal of full automation and integration of test cases and approvals within the integration testing process will revolutionize and streamline the way we approach software development, making it more efficient, reliable, and scalable.

    Customer Testimonials:


    "The prioritized recommendations in this dataset have added tremendous value to my work. The accuracy and depth of insights have exceeded my expectations. A fantastic resource for decision-makers in any industry."

    "The data in this dataset is clean, well-organized, and easy to work with. It made integration into my existing systems a breeze."

    "Five stars for this dataset! The prioritized recommendations are invaluable, and the attention to detail is commendable. It has quickly become an essential tool in my toolkit."



    Integration Testing Case Study/Use Case example - How to use:



    Case Study: Integration Testing and Automated Approval Processes in Project Management

    Synopsis of Client Situation:

    The client is a large software development company that specializes in providing custom software solutions to its clients across various industries. The company operates on the agile development methodology and has a team of skilled developers, testers, and project managers. The success of their projects depends upon the quality of the software delivered to the clients within the estimated time and budget.

    The company has been facing challenges in managing frequent changes in their projects, which have led to delays in project delivery and increased costs. This frequently happens due to the lack of an automated approval process in their integration testing phase. As a result, the client is seeking a solution to automate the approval process and improve efficiency in project management.

    Consulting Methodology:

    To address the client′s challenges, our consulting firm conducted a thorough analysis of the company′s project management processes, specifically focused on the integration testing phase. Our team utilized the Industry-leading consulting methodologies, including DMAIC (Define, Measure, Analyze, Improve, and Control) and SIPOC (Supplier, Input, Process, Output, Customer), to understand the client′s current processes, identify gaps, and develop an automated approval process.

    Deliverables:

    1. Detailed analysis report: Our consulting team conducted an in-depth analysis of the client′s project management processes, with a particular focus on the integration testing phase. The report identified areas of improvement and provided recommendations for an automated approval process.

    2. Automated approval process design: Based on the analysis report, our team designed an automated approval process for the integration testing phase. The process incorporated industry best practices and was tailored to fit the client′s specific needs.

    3. Implementation plan: We developed a step-by-step plan for implementing the automated approval process in the client′s organization. The plan included training and change management strategies to ensure a smooth transition.

    Implementation Challenges:

    The implementation of the automated approval process faced some challenges, including resistance to change and the need for additional resources to oversee and manage the process. The team also faced technical challenges in integrating the new process with the existing project management tools. To overcome these challenges, our consulting team closely collaborated with the client′s project management team and provided support and guidance throughout the implementation process.

    KPIs:

    1. Reduction in project delivery time: The primary KPI for the success of this project was to reduce the project delivery time by automating the approval process. With a manual approval process, the integration testing phase used to take an average of 7 days. After implementing the automated approval process, the time was reduced to just 2 days, resulting in a 71% improvement.

    2. Decrease in project costs: Through automation, the client experienced a significant decrease in project costs due to the reduction in project delivery time. This resulted in increased profitability and client satisfaction.

    3. Improvement in project quality: The automated approval process helped in detecting and eliminating errors earlier in the project cycle, leading to better quality software being delivered to clients.

    Management Considerations:

    The successful implementation of the automated approval process has brought about several benefits for the client. It has not only improved efficiency and reduced costs but has also improved communication and collaboration between the different teams involved in project management. The approval process is now more agile and transparent, which has increased trust and accountability among team members.

    Furthermore, the client can now easily identify and address any non-value added activities in their project management processes through the use of automation. The management teams can also utilize data and analytics from the automated approval process to make informed decisions, further improving overall project performance.

    Conclusion:

    In conclusion, our consulting firm successfully assisted the client in implementing an automated approval process for their integration testing phase. Through the use of industry-leading consulting methodologies and close collaboration with the client′s project management team, we were able to identify and address key challenges faced by the client. The implementation of an automated approval process has not only improved the efficiency and quality of projects delivered, but it has also increased profitability and client satisfaction. The success of this project highlights the importance and benefits of automating approval processes in project management, particularly in the integration testing phase.

    Security and Trust:


    • Secure checkout with SSL encryption Visa, Mastercard, Apple Pay, Google Pay, Stripe, Paypal
    • Money-back guarantee for 30 days
    • Our team is available 24/7 to assist you - support@theartofservice.com


    About the Authors: Unleashing Excellence: The Mastery of Service Accredited by the Scientific Community

    Immerse yourself in the pinnacle of operational wisdom through The Art of Service`s Excellence, now distinguished with esteemed accreditation from the scientific community. With an impressive 1000+ citations, The Art of Service stands as a beacon of reliability and authority in the field.

    Our dedication to excellence is highlighted by meticulous scrutiny and validation from the scientific community, evidenced by the 1000+ citations spanning various disciplines. Each citation attests to the profound impact and scholarly recognition of The Art of Service`s contributions.

    Embark on a journey of unparalleled expertise, fortified by a wealth of research and acknowledgment from scholars globally. Join the community that not only recognizes but endorses the brilliance encapsulated in The Art of Service`s Excellence. Enhance your understanding, strategy, and implementation with a resource acknowledged and embraced by the scientific community.

    Embrace excellence. Embrace The Art of Service.

    Your trust in us aligns you with prestigious company; boasting over 1000 academic citations, our work ranks in the top 1% of the most cited globally. Explore our scholarly contributions at: https://scholar.google.com/scholar?hl=en&as_sdt=0%2C5&q=blokdyk

    About The Art of Service:

    Our clients seek confidence in making risk management and compliance decisions based on accurate data. However, navigating compliance can be complex, and sometimes, the unknowns are even more challenging.

    We empathize with the frustrations of senior executives and business owners after decades in the industry. That`s why The Art of Service has developed Self-Assessment and implementation tools, trusted by over 100,000 professionals worldwide, empowering you to take control of your compliance assessments. With over 1000 academic citations, our work stands in the top 1% of the most cited globally, reflecting our commitment to helping businesses thrive.

    Founders:

    Gerard Blokdyk
    LinkedIn: https://www.linkedin.com/in/gerardblokdijk/

    Ivanka Menken
    LinkedIn: https://www.linkedin.com/in/ivankamenken/